Wayne's Autoglass: A Tale of Two Experiences & Local Support
Wayne's Autoglass, located at 50 Kioreroa Road in Port Whangārei, Whangārei, NZ, holds a solid 4.6-star rating based on customer feedback. This reflects a mixed bag of experiences; while some customers sing their praises for friendly service and competitive pricing, others have voiced serious concerns regarding workmanship and accountability. The business operates Monday to Friday, 9 AM–4:30 PM, and is closed on weekends. They offer onsite services and accept credit/debit cards, prioritizing accessibility with a wheelchair-friendly entrance and parking lot. Appointments are recommended for smooth service. The Downsides: A Concerning Pattern of Quality and Communication
One customer shared a particularly disappointing experience involving two vehicles. The replacement of a rear glass resulted in leftover glass rattling within the panel and, critically, damaging the boot latch – a significant repair on a German vehicle. Attempts to rectify this resulted in a refusal to accept responsibility, despite an acknowledgement of the high likelihood of failure when glass residue is left behind. Further compounding the issue, the window frame was dented during glass removal. A similar problem arose with a work van, where a poorly reattached rearview mirror compromised visibility. Beyond the workmanship itself, the customer detailed concerns regarding:
- Unexpected Price Increases: Charges exceeded the original quote.
- Excessive Waiting Time: A delay in sourcing the correct glass left vehicles undrivable for an extended period.
- Lack of Site Cleanliness: Broken glass scattered across the driveway following the work.
- Lack of Accountability: Refusal to address critical errors and their consequences.
This individual strongly advises against using Wayne’s Autoglass, citing a lack of care, accountability, and attention to detail leading to inconvenience and added expense. The Shining Examples: Exceptional Service & Genuine Care
Despite the criticisms mentioned above, a significant number of customers have lauded Wayne's Autoglass for its exceptional service and genuine local feel. Many highlight the team's proactive approach and the personal touch often missing from larger corporations. Consider these testimonials:
- Insurance Liaison & Respect: One customer praised the team's assistance in liaising with their 92-year-old father-in-law's insurer and for their friendly, helpful, and respectful demeanor. They appreciated the extra time taken for a chat and the thorough cleaning of the windscreen.
- Price Negotiation & Value: Another customer was offered a cheaper windscreen upon willing to wait an extra day, demonstrating a commitment to providing the best possible price.
- Rapid Turnaround & Attention to Detail: A customer praised the 3-hour windscreen replacement turnaround, especially considering it was performed over the Christmas/New Year period, and the care taken to return the car in the same condition.
- Prioritising People: Several reviews repeatedly mention the team's tendency to put people before profits, indicating a strong commitment to customer satisfaction.
- Supporting Local: Customers actively encourage others to support this family-owned business instead of larger chains.
